4 Simple Steps to Safeguard Your Furry Friend: Mastering the Art of Proper Harness Fitting

By following these four simple steps, pet owners can ensure their furry friends are comfortable, secure, and well-equipped for their daily adventures:

Step 1: Choose the Right Harness for Your Pet

Select a harness that matches your pet's size, breed, and activity level. Consider factors such as comfort, adjustability, and durability.

Step 2: Measure and Adjust the Harness

Use a tape measure or consult with a veterinarian to determine the ideal harness measurement for your pet. Make any necessary adjustments to ensure a comfortable and secure fit.

Step 3: Inspect and Maintain the Harness

Regularly inspect the harness for signs of wear or damage. Clean and maintain the harness to ensure optimal performance and extend its lifespan.

Step 4: Introduce the Harness Gradually

Gradually introduce the harness to your pet, beginning with short periods and gradually increasing the duration. Reward your pet with treats and praise to associate the harness with positive experiences.
